Sign in to follow this  
Followers 0
dmitriusukach

Google-таблицы парсинг

5 posts in this topic

Добрый день. Вопрос следующий. касается Гугол-таблиц. Есть список URL. По формуле с этого списка - парсятся заголовки страниц. Если он один (заголовок H3) - он - просто, как и нужно - прописывается напротив в соседнем столбце. Но если их несколько, выбивает ошибку !ССЫЛ (Массив не выведен, поскольку это привело бы к перезаписи в следующей строке; что понятно и логично). Проблема в том, что нужно - предусматривать место для заголовков H3 (нужно спарсить H2 - H3), т.к. их может быть 2 или 5, к примеру. И чтобы, когда я растягиваю формулу, относительно урл - появлялись и заголовки, то есть формировались дополнительные строки. Как это сделать? Фото вложил Заранее спасибо

В общем, чтобы в конечном итогу - было так - https://drive.google.com/open?id=188mkNOgCCp2MOXGoqoTmKII50czVbFj7

 

 

Share this post


Link to post
Share on other sites

Ну так а почему бы не записывать все h3 в одну ячейку? Просто каждый заголовок делайте с новой строки..

Share this post


Link to post
Share on other sites
1 час назад, WebProger сказал:

Ну так а почему бы не записывать все h3 в одну ячейку? Просто каждый заголовок делайте с новой строки..

Подскажите как?

Share this post


Link to post
Share on other sites

=СЦЕПИТЬ(IMPORTXML(B2;"//h3")

Сцепить, сцепил, но не получается в ячейке перенос строки сделать

Share this post


Link to post
Share on other sites

Вы это программно записываете или вручную?

По идее у вас должен быть массив заголовков h3, который перед записью можно преобразовать в строку

$h3 = implode("\r\n", $h3);

 

Share this post


Link to post
Share on other sites

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!


Register a new account

Sign in

Already have an account? Sign in here.


Sign In Now
Sign in to follow this  
Followers 0

  • Recently Browsing   0 members

    No registered users viewing this page.